<p>From a home in the small Swedish town of Eskilstuna, this place has that industrial, slightly retro vibe that seems so typical of Swedish interiors (if we&#8217;re going by what the design mags tell us, anyway). The tile, wood-framed cabinets, stainless appliances and big wooden table are so tightly designed that the effect borders on austere. But those chairs! The bright green colour and fun shape add a playful edge that makes the room what it is.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I don&#8217;t usually read <a href="http://www.coastalliving.com/">Coastal Living</a>, but now and then I like to browse their site for design inspiration. The featured homes always have a charming, homespun, Cape Cod sort of feel, but every so often I&#8217;ll find something surprising. </p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-945" title="green coastal kitchen" src="http://www.kitchenisms.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/07/green-kitchen.jpg" alt="green coastal kitchen" width="400" height="400" /></p>
<p>Case in point: <a href="http://www.coastalliving.com/homes/decorating/coastal-kitchen-00400000027797/page3.html">this contemporary kitchen</a>. Not only do I love the colour of the cabinets (I know, <em>so</em> predicable), but I like the fun use of typography, too. The fact that the floors and countertops are the same colour keeps things streamlined horizontally, and stops the ceiling-height cabinets from taking over the space. The pendant lights and hints of red are also great, though I could pass on the crazy paneled ceiling.</p>
